The product declares that the only natural defecation posture for a human is squatting, and that doing so with the Squatty Potty can assist in better elimination. If you have actually ever had a bout of constipation, you comprehend the fascination with "having an excellent poop." So, does the Squatty Potty truly work? Can it actually help you attain a much faster and more effective elimination like its site says? "There's no proof one method or another how people are expected to have a bowel motion." How Does the Squatty Potty Work? The Squatty Potty is a curved stool that nests against your toilet and raises your feet, transforming your "sitting" posture to a "squatting" posture. squatty potty shark tank.
However, some individuals may have the right angle simply by sitting and attempting various toilet positions, Dr. Reed says. "It's really about getting the sigmoid colon (last sector of colon just prior to the anus) to correct out," he describes - squatty potty dimensions. In addition, numerous other factors like diet, activity level, medications and general health affect the makeup of your stool and how easy it is to get rid of.
Reed says (does squatty potty work). "Some don't have bulk, or their bowels are slow. Whether they remain in the best position or the moons are lined up, it still may not help." He recommends resolving these elements initially to solve constipation, potentially preventing the need for a product like the Squatty Potty in the very first place.
